Capacity note: the Quillbrook sweeper scans for orphaned volumes, stale tokens, and detached replicas across all Harrowgate tenants. Each sweep pass is rate-limited to avoid starving the control-plane API; a full pass at current fleet size takes ~40 minutes. Security-relevant: sweep credentials are scoped read-delete only, and deletion requires two consecutive orphan verdicts separated by the quarantine window. Memory footprint scales linearly with candidate count. The operative limits are captured in the constants below.

tuning constants:
QUOTAS = {
    "druwyn": 5,
    "holix": 5,
    "zorath": 5,
    "holwyn": 10,
}

## Runbook: Formula sandbox (Quillpad)

User-supplied formulas in Quillpad spreadsheets are evaluated inside the sandbox runner, which caps CPU time, memory, and recursion depth, and strips all I/O builtins. If the runner crashes or formulas start timing out en masse, check that the sandbox limits haven't been loosened by a stray override file in the pod. Restarting the runner re-reads limits from the mounted config. The sandbox runs with the following values.

config for kafof-bawef:
holath:
  log_level: debug
  metrics_host: metrics.holath.qorvelsys.internal
  pin: 2191
  pool_size: 32

Welcome to on-call for Fernwick Calc! Quick heads-up: user-supplied formulas run inside the Quillbox sandbox, never on the main eval host. If the sandbox wedges, don't restart it manually — use the break-glass reset in the Tally console. That reset prompts for the sandbox recovery passphrase, which is:

unlock words, hahip-baduf: holwyn-istath-julvan